logo

Output 77d243563770203e2888ec8c97f97d94faf0ea908c5b13610bbd5762e863dcae:1

value
203144944
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c88852a0e09868f54358f851876a029ecbc016c OP_EQUALVERIFY OP_CHECKSIG
address
154UH2ehjZFUxyWYHNCP3jLkcb8nd3Uymc
transaction
77d243563770203e2888ec8c97f97d94faf0ea908c5b13610bbd5762e863dcae